Bradley Piesco is a seasoned financial executive with over 20 years of experience in financial management, currently serving as the Sr. Director of Finance at Navitas Business Consulting, Inc. In this pivotal role, Brad has established himself as the highest-ranking finance leader, driving the company's strategic vision and spearheading targeted sector growth initiatives that have led to exponential revenue increases. His extensive background in problem-solving and analytical skills has been instrumental in navigating complex financial landscapes, particularly in the realms of government contracting and private equity.
One of Brad's key achievements at Navitas has been the successful implementation of a federal ERP system, transitioning the company from QuickBooks to Unanet. This significant migration involved the meticulous transfer of two years’ worth of project data, showcasing his expertise in program management and enterprise software integration. By “rolling up his sleeves” and actively managing this project, Brad ensured a seamless transition that not only improved operational efficiency but also enhanced the overall financial reporting capabilities of the organization.
In addition to his technical skills, Brad's experience in new business acquisition and strategic planning has allowed him to identify and capitalize on emerging market opportunities. His leadership in business process improvement initiatives has further solidified Navitas's competitive edge in the consulting industry. With a proven track record in operations management and a deep understanding of financial dynamics, Bradley Piesco continues to be a vital asset to Navitas Business Consulting, driving innovation and fostering sustainable growth.
